- 13
- 0
- 约4.29千字
- 约 35页
- 2022-05-29 发布于四川
- 举报
第5章 MCS-51的定时器/计数器;5.1 定时器/计数器的结构;5.2 定时器/计数器的工作原理;5.3 定时器/计数器的控制5.3.1 定时器/计数器方式控制寄存器TMOD;1、M1和M0工作方式控制位M0和M1为工作方式控制位,确定4种工作方式,如表5-1所示。;2、 定时器/计数器方式选择位
=0,定时方式,对机器周期进行计数;
=1,计数方式,对外部信号进行计数,外部信号接至T0(P3.4)或T1(P3.5)引脚。
3、GATE门控位
GATE=0时,只要用软件使TR0(或TR1)置1就能启动定时器T0(或T1);
GATE=1时,只有在INT0(或INT1)引脚为高电平的情况下,且由软件使TR0(或TR1)置1时,才能启动定时器T0(或T1)工作;5.3.2 定时器/计数器的控制寄存器TCON
控制寄存器TCON的位地址是88H,可以对它进行位寻址。其功能:
(1)启动:设定好了定时器/计数器的工作方式后,通过设置控制寄存器TCON中的相应位来启动。
(2)停止:要使定时器/计数器停止运行,也通过设置TCON中的相应位来实现。
(3)标志:TCON能标明溢出和中断情况。;1. TR0:定时器T1运行控制位。可由软件置1(或清零)来启动(或关闭)定时器T0,使定时器T0开始计数。。
2. TF0:定时
原创力文档

文档评论(0)